| Analytical Chemistry | QD71-QD142 |
| Inorganic Chemistry | QD146-QD197 |
| Organic Chemistry | QD241-QD441 |
| Biochemistry | QD415-QD436 |
| Physical and Theoretical Chemistry | QD450-QD801 |
| Photochemistry | QD701-QD731 |
| Crystallography | QD901-QD999 |
| Genetics | QH426-QH470 |
| Animal Biochemistry | QP501-QP801 |
| Pharmacology | RM1-RM931 |
| Chemical Technology | TP1-TP1185 |
